KT21 2PR is a small residential postcode area in England, home to just 1,598 people. This compact cluster of homes is characterised by a mature demographic, with a median age of 47 and a strong presence of adults aged 30–64. The area is predominantly owner-occupied, with 92% of residents living in their own homes, and the housing stock is largely composed of houses rather than flats. Located near Leatherhead, the area benefits from proximity to local amenities and transport links. Daily life here is shaped by a quiet, family-oriented atmosphere, supported by low crime rates and minimal environmental risks. Residents enjoy access to essential services, including a top-rated primary school and multiple retail outlets. The area’s small size means it is easy to navigate, with a sense of community fostered by its close-knit nature. For those seeking a stable, low-maintenance environment with good connectivity, KT21 2PR offers a blend of practicality and convenience.

The lifestyle in KT21 2PR is shaped by its proximity to essential amenities, including five retail outlets such as Morrisons Daily and Sainsburys Leatherhead, which provide everyday shopping convenience. The area’s rail network, with stations like Leatherhead and Epsom, ensures easy access to nearby towns for work, leisure, or socialising. A ferry landing at Ditton Island adds a unique touch, offering opportunities for boating or scenic trips. While the area lacks extensive parks or leisure facilities, its small size and quiet nature make it ideal for those who prioritise proximity to services over large-scale recreation. The presence of a top-rated primary school further enhances its appeal for families. KT21 2PR is served by St Peter’s Catholic Primary School, a primary school with an Ofsted rating of outstanding. This indicates a high standard of education, which is a significant advantage for families with young children. The absence of secondary schools in the immediate vicinity means parents may need to consider nearby towns for secondary education, but the quality of the primary school alone makes the area attractive for families.
